Service recovery paradox. The service recovery paradox (SRP) is a situation in which a customer thinks more highly of a company after the company has corrected a problem with their service, compared to how they would regard the company if non-faulty service had been provided. Service recovery. Service recovery is an organization's resolution of problems from dissatisfied customers, converting those customers into loyal customers.
